Catch And Release
Kody Kubala (center), a 2006 El Campo High School graduate and treasurer of the Sul Ross State University Range and Wildlife Club, holds down this mule deer buck that he helped capture Dec. 15 on the Black Mesa Ranch located south of Alpine. He and four other Natural Resource students from SRSU volunteered to help capture a total of 72 deer in a 2-day period for a student from Texas A&M Kingsville. After capturing each deer, they tagged, performed ultra sounds, age and DNA testing and put GPS colors on the deer. Son of Darlene and Wayne Kubala, he had a 3.4 grade point average this past semester. He has plans of doing an undergraduate project next year over the Collared Peccary, commonly referred to as a Javelina. Kubala plans to graduate in two years with a bachelor of science in natural resource management to become certified wildlife biologist.
